Ordinals
beta
Sat 87564718501173
decimal
17512.4718501173
degree
0°17512′1384″4718501173‴
percentile
4.169748504642583%
name
nfpvcdwrpey
cycle
0
epoch
0
period
8
block
17512
offset
4718501173
timestamp
2009-06-19 02:33:52 UTC
rarity
common
prev
next